Hiking in Imboden, located in the canton of Graubünden, Switzerland, offers diverse landscapes for outdoor enthusiasts. The region is characterized by majestic mountains, lush valleys, and scenic rivers, including the dramatic Rhine Gorge. Hikers can explore trails through alpine meadows and coniferous forests, with the turquoise Lake Cauma being a notable natural highlight. This area provides a variety of easy hiking trails suitable for different ability levels.

RhB Reichenau-Tamins Station A fascinatingly different journey since 1889. With our unique mountain routes, the UNESCO World Heritage Site, the Glacier Express, and the Bernina Express, we have been providing fascinating railway experiences across Graubünden since 1889. Our world-famous railway has become an integral part of one of Switzerland's most beautiful landscapes. What began in 1889 with the opening of the line from Landquart to Klosters is now a 385-kilometer-long network of routes amidst the Swiss high mountains. Harmoniously embedded in the wild nature, the railway lines and engineering structures contribute to the charm of Graubünden. 1896 - Opening of the Landquart – Thusis line 1903 - Opening of the Reichenau – Ilanz line 1912 Purchase of the first electric locomotive; Opening of the Ilanz – Disentis/Mustér line Text / Source: Rhaetian Railway AG, Bahnhofstrasse 25, Chur https://www.rhb.ch/de/unternehmen/portraet/geschichte

Imboden offers a wide selection of easy hiking trails, with over 120 routes suitable for various fitness levels. These trails are highly rated by the komoot community, averaging 4.6 stars from over 2,800 reviews.
Easy hikes in Imboden traverse diverse landscapes, from lush valleys and scenic riverbanks to alpine meadows and coniferous forests. You'll encounter majestic mountains in the distance and natural highlights like the turquoise Lake Cauma. The region is also known for the dramatic Rhine Gorge, often called the 'Swiss Grand Canyon'.
Yes, Imboden features several easy circular routes. A popular option is the Lake Cresta circular hike, which is 2.9 miles (4.6 km) long and offers an accessible way to enjoy the scenery. Another is the Caumasee Lakeside Trail – View of Lake Cauma loop from Flims, a 3.5-mile (5.6 km) path around the stunning Lake Cauma.
Many easy trails in Imboden are suitable for families. Routes around Lake Cresta and Lake Cauma are particularly popular for their gentle terrain and beautiful views. The Sardona Mountain Flower Trail is another easy option that showcases diverse alpine flora, making it an engaging walk for children.
Absolutely. Many easy trails offer stunning viewpoints. For instance, the View of the Ruinaulta Gorge – Prau la Selva High Ropes Park loop from Flims provides vistas of the impressive Rhine Gorge. Trails around Flims also offer panoramic views of Lake Cauma. You can also visit the Dreibündenstein Monument for historical significance and views.
Yes, several easy routes pass by or lead to interesting landmarks. You can explore historical sites like Reichenau Castle or the Belmont Castle Ruins. Natural attractions include the Confluence of the Vorderrhein and Hinterrhein. Some trails also lead near cultural stops or mountain huts.
The best time for easy hikes in Imboden is typically from late spring to early autumn (May to October), when the weather is mild, and alpine meadows are in bloom. However, some trails, like the Bargis Valley – Beautiful winter hiking trail loop from Burgruine Belmont, are specifically designed for winter, offering a different kind of scenic experience.
Imboden, being part of Graubünden, benefits from Switzerland's excellent public transport network. Many trailheads are accessible by bus or train, especially in areas like Flims Laax Falera. It's advisable to check local bus schedules for specific routes to ensure convenient access to your chosen starting point.
While popular spots like Lake Cauma can attract visitors, Imboden's extensive network of trails means you can often find quieter paths. Exploring routes slightly off the main tourist hubs or visiting during off-peak hours can lead to a more serene hiking experience. The region's vastness allows for many peaceful strolls through forests and valleys.
Even on easy hikes, it's wise to be prepared. Bring comfortable walking shoes, layers of clothing suitable for changing mountain weather, water, snacks, and sun protection. A small first-aid kit and a fully charged phone are also recommended. For routes showcasing flora, a field guide might enhance your experience.
Yes, Imboden offers specific trails that are maintained for winter hiking. An example is the Bargis Valley – Beautiful winter hiking trail loop from Burgruine Belmont. These trails provide a unique opportunity to experience the snow-covered alpine landscape safely. Always check local conditions and trail status before heading out in winter.
